Status of the Offensive Line

The offensive line, already Seattle’s most volatile unit
took another blow Sunday against Tampa Bay.
Pro Bowl center Max Unger left the game with a concussion.
His status for next week’s game at Atlanta is unknown.
The Seahawks are already without offensive tackles Russell Okung and Breno Giacomini,
who are still a couple weeks from returning. Okung, though, returned to practice Friday
and Giacomini is scheduled to return this week. Both worked out with
offensive line coach Tom Cable on the field before the game.
In addition to losing Unger, the Seahawks shuffled the line around by making an in-game change.
Seattle took out guard James Carpenter and slid over Paul McQuistan from tackle to fill the guard position.
The Seahawks then inserted undrafted rookie Alvin Bailey at tackle, although that only lasted temporarily.
